/en/
en
true
803
42243
905
33
949
27996
Helsinki
helsinki
129
Helsinki
60.174797
24.943085
12
183
true
1,2,3,5,7,8
510
43142
417
1495
11922
2
405444
Map
Street ViewExplore
AddressAsematie